October 23, 2008 7:13 am Daily life, fishI had 0ppm of ammonia today! Whoo hoo! Translation: my tank filter has grown enough bacteria that it will eat my fish’s waste so the tank doesn’t act like a big unflushed toilet they swim around in!
However, the bacteria that is eating the ammonia makes another waste product even more dangerous called nitrite. Now the next type of bacteria needs to grow a large enough colony to eat the nitrites… which I will know happened when my nitrite is also at 0ppm. I’m about 2/3 of the way home.
Home school moms- this would be a great science experiment. And your kids will feel very scientific with test tubes for measuring ammonia, nitrite and nitrate. However, you may end up with a fish when you are done.
**update: for the record- specifically my record when I try to recall later how long it took to cycle a tank- I had my first 0ppm reading of Nitrite on Nov. 9th. 30 days total.
